What problem does it solve?

Inter-skill artifact protocol. Defines how skills discover and consume prior skill outputs, handle multi-artifact handoffs, track artifact lifecycle, and clean up after consumption. Not a slash command — loaded automatically to enable skill chaining.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Provides a formal mechanism for artifacts produced by skills to be published via standardized handoff manifests, enabling downstream skills to discover, read, and coordinate consumption.
  • Supports single- and multi-artifact outputs with per-artifact metadata, status, and downstream consumption guidance.
  • Enforces lifecycle policies (consumption, archiving, audit trails) and supports optional design-tool extensions and upstream references.
